Remote Key Fob Repairs You Can Do at Home

You might be enticed, in the event that your remote key fob isn't working and you are unable to use it, to take it to a dealership to get it reprogrammed. Instead, try some quick fixes at home.

Start by replacing the battery. Hardware stores sell flat-watch-style batteries that are inexpensive and easy to locate. Take a closer look at the fob that you have purchased and look for buttons that are worn or out of place.

Dead Battery

The key fob is a tiny electronic device that makes it simple to lock key repair near me or unlock your car. It works by using a radio transmitter that transmits codes to a receiver in your car. Key fob batteries typically last for a long period of time, but they could end up dying at any time. Check the LED light, or try pressing one of the buttons to determine whether the battery is dead. If the key fob won't respond then the battery is dead and must be replaced.

The process of replacing the battery in a key fob is easy and quick. It's usually just opening the fob and taking out the battery that was in use, and then inserting the new one. Batteries for fobs are small, like those found in hearing aids or watches. They are available at home improvement stores and general stores. They're usually shaped like a small coin, and feature plus and minus symbols on the bottom. Check out the owner's manual or the label on your key fob if aren't sure which batteries your fob uses.

Buttons Aren't Responding

It could be worn out button sensor if you've driven for a long period of time and notice that your keys don't work. Most fobs feature rubberized buttons which wear out over time, which could cause them to only work correctly if they are pushed in a particular way or with extreme force. This is a common issue for many fobs, and can be easily solved by following a few DIY steps.

To unlock the car the fob sends an indication to the receiver in the car. If the receiver is damaged, it could stop receiving the signal and will prevent the key from functioning to open or start the vehicle. This can be fixed by having a mechanic examine the receiver to determine if there is damage. In most cases, this will be free or a small fee according to the make of the car you own.

Keychain Loop Breaks

If the key fob's keychain loop is damaged, it can be separated from your keys and can no longer be used to lock or unlock your car. The keychain loop is easily replaced.

Water damage and moisture can also cause key fobs to malfunction with a variety of symptoms, including reduced range of operation or even no function at all. Drying the key fob and replacing the battery can fix the issue, but sometimes an expert repair or replacement is required.

Over time the buttons on key fobs can wear out and become less responsive or ineffective. It could be necessary to replace the key fob's button or case however, reprogramming may solve the issue. Sometimes, signal interference from nearby electronic devices could interfere with the connection between the key fob and your vehicle, leading to problems with locking or unlocking. It could be necessary to conduct a diagnostic check at the dealership in order to resolve the issue. This is usually the case with older electronic keys that rely on infrared signals for operation and require a line-of-sight. Most modern microchipped keys communicate with your car using radio frequency to authorize a challenge.
